Reconsidering the Backyard as Livable Space
Lots of backyards start out as easy patches of turf or underused patios. But that does not suggest they need to remain by doing this. The secret to creating a retreat hinges on reimagining your exterior area as a true living location, similar to your family room or dining location. Beginning by thinking about exactly how you naturally appreciate hanging around. Do you long for quiet nights with a book? Are you a person that flourishes when organizing weekend barbecues or exterior film evenings? Allow your way of life guide the layout.
From shaded seats areas and garden sidewalks to fully-equipped outside cooking areas, the opportunities are as varied as the people that appreciate them. Rather than restricting your vision to the dimension of the lawn, think about exactly how to split the area into zones. One location can act as an eating space, another as a relaxation nook, and an additional for entertainment or horticulture.

Bringing Warmth and Character Through Natural Materials
The products you pick for your exterior room issue-- not just for appearances, but also for just how the area feels. Natural materials like wood have a heat and natural appeal that mixes effortlessly with the outdoors. Whether you're developing a pergola or selecting flooring for your deck, wood decking offers both classic charm and longevity.
Wood supplies a grounding impact that assists individuals really feel much more linked to nature. Unlike artificial materials, it ages with dignity, often creating a rich aging that includes personality gradually. With the best coating and upkeep, timber can withstand the aspects and stay a highlight of your outdoor retreat for years.

Attaching the Indoors and Outdoors Seamlessly
A successful outside hideaway does not simply sit at the rear of your residence; it feels like an organic expansion of your interior space. That implies taking into consideration layout, web traffic circulation, and aesthetic consistency. Consider exactly how you move from your kitchen or living space right into the backyard. Huge gliding doors or French doors can open the area and make the transition feel simple and easy.
Flooring materials, shade palettes, and style styles that resemble your indoor design can assist connect every little thing with each other. For instance, if your home has a rustic, farmhouse look, you may select troubled wood and wrought-iron fixtures outside. If your style is much more contemporary, you can carry that through with tidy lines and neutral tones.

Creating Year-Round Use and Enjoyment
While outside living is typically associated with cozy months, a properly designed resort can offer you throughout the year. Features like fire pits, outside heaters, and covered areas can expand your enjoyment well right into the cooler periods. With just a few enhancements, your yard can end up being a year-round refuge instead of a summer-only hangout.
Consider just how you can adapt the area as the periods change. Removable pillows, weather-resistant materials, and layered illumination remedies can maintain points practical and eye-catching regardless of the weather condition.
